About Shahriar Shahi
Shahriar Shahi is a scholar working on Oral Surgery, Orthodontics and Medical Laboratory Technology, having authored 83 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Endodontics and Root Canal Treatments (74 papers), Dental Radiography and Imaging (54 papers), Dental materials and restorations (34 papers), Dental Anxiety and Anesthesia Techniques (13 papers), Drilling and Well Engineering (7 papers), Occupational health in dentistry (5 papers), Concrete and Cement Materials Research (4 papers) and Dental Trauma and Treatments (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Oral Surgery (1.5k citations), Orthodontics (637 citations) and Medical Laboratory Technology (64 citations). Shahriar Shahi has collaborated with scholars based in Iran, Belgium and United States. Frequent co-authors include Saeed Rahimi, Hamid Reza Yavari, Mehrdad Lotfi, Majid Abdolrahimi, Mohammad Samiei, Saeed Nezafati, Negin Ghasemi, Amin Salem Milani, Vahid Zand and Mohammad Froughreyhani.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Carbohydrate Polymers and Journal of Endodontics.
